STRUCTURE STUDIES OF NEW ANTISWEET CONSTITUENT FROM GYMNEMA SYLVESTRE
Yoshikawa, Kazuko,Amimoto, Kayoko,Arihara, Shigenobu,Matsuura, Kouji
, p. 1103 - 1106 (2007/10/02)
Gymnemic acid I, II, III and IV have been isolated from hot water extract of leaves of Gymnema sylvestre R.Br. as antisweet principles.The whole structure were determined by chemical and spectroscopic means.
ESTABLISHMENT OF THE STRUCTURE OF GYMNEMAGENIN BY X-RAY ANALYSIS AND THE STRUCTURE OF DEACYLGYMNEMIC ACID
Tsuda, Yoshisuke,Kiuchi, Fumiyuki,Liu, Hong-Min
, p. 361 - 362 (2007/10/02)
The strucuture of gymnemagenin, the sapogenin of antisweet principle of Gymnema syrvestre, was firmly established as 3β,16β,21β,22α,23,28-hexahydroxy-olean-12-ene by the X-ray analysis of the 3β,23;21β,22α-di-O-isopropylidine derivative.On the basis of this result, the structure of deacylgymnemic acid was elucidated as the 3-O-β-glucuronide by comparison of the 13C-NMR spectra.
Studies on the Constituents of Xanthoceras sorbifolia BUNGE. III. Minor Prosapogenins from the Fruits of Xanthoceras sorbifolia BUNGE
Chen, Yingjie,Takeda, Tadahiro,Ogihara, Yukio
, p. 127 - 134 (2007/10/02)
The prosapogenins from the fruits of Xanthoceras sorbifolia BUNGE (Sapindaceae) were examined.On the basis of chemical and spectral analyses, the structures of three minor prosapogenins, obtained by acid hydrolysis of crude saponin fraction, were characterized as 21-O-(3,4-di-O-angeloyl)-β-D-fucopyranosyl theasapogenol B (1), 21-O-(4-O-acetyl-3-O-angeloyl)-β-D-fucopyranosyl theasapogenol B (2) and 21-O-(4-O-acetyl-3-O-angeloyl)-β-D-fucopyranosyl-22-O-acetyl protoaescigenin (3), respectively.
